Store › David Bowie - Ziggy Stardust and the Spiders from Mars Image 1 of 1 David Bowie - Ziggy Stardust and the Spiders from Mars $28.89 Bowie’s concept album for the film of the same name. Released in 73. Add To Cart Added! Bowie’s concept album for the film of the same name. Released in 73.